背景:脐带间充质干细胞在成脂培养条件下成脂相关信号因子过氧化物酶体增殖体激活受体γ的表达水平增高,同时成骨相关信号因子骨形态发生蛋白的表达水平也增高。目的:检测成脂诱导条件下脐带间充质干细胞的过氧化物酶体增殖体激活受体γ及骨形态发生蛋白2的表达水平变化,并对结果进行初步探讨。方法:取脐带来源的间充质干细胞,以成脂诱导体系对细胞进行诱导分化培养,倒置显微镜下观察细胞体外培养生长情况;油红O染色法观察成脂现象,茜素红及vonkossa染色观察是否有沉淀形成;荧光定量PCR方法检测成脂相关因子过氧化物酶体增殖体激活受体γ及骨形态发生蛋白2的表达变化情况。结果与结论:获得脐带来源间充质干细胞,并成功进行了成脂诱导分化。荧光定量PCR检测发现在成脂诱导条件下脐带间充质干细胞的过氧化物酶体增殖体激活受体γ和骨形态发生蛋白2的表达水平全都呈升高趋势,但是前者对分化方向的调控起主要作用。
BACKGROUND: Umbilical cord mesenchymal stem cells (MSCs) express adipogenic-related signaling molecules peroxisome proliferator activated receptor γ in adipogenic medium and increase the expression of osteogenesis-associated signaling factor (BMP). OBJECTIVE: To detect the changes of peroxisome proliferator activated receptor gamma and bone morphogenetic protein 2 expression in umbilical cord mesenchymal stem cells under the condition of adipogenic induction, and to study the results preliminarily. Methods: The umbilical cord-derived mesenchymal stem cells were harvested and the cells were induced to differentiate and differentiate with adipogenic induction system. The growth of the cells in vitro was observed under inverted microscope. The adipogenic behavior was observed by oil red O staining. Alizarin red and vonkossa staining Whether there was precipitation or not; the expression of peroxisome proliferator-activated receptor gamma and bone morphogenetic protein 2 were detected by fluorescence quantitative PCR. RESULTS AND CONCLUSION: Umbilical cord-derived mesenchymal stem cells were obtained and adipogenic differentiation was successfully performed. Fluorescent quantitative PCR showed that the expression of peroxisome proliferator-activated receptor gamma and bone morphogenetic protein 2 in umbilical cord mesenchymal stem cells all showed an increasing trend under the condition of adipogenic induction, but the regulation of the differentiation direction is a main factor.
